Built with a MediaTek Helio G85 processor, 4GB of RAM, and 64GB of storage, the Tab One is the perfect starter tablet for students or casual home use. The 8.7-inch display delivers 1340 x 800 resolution and a max brightness of 480 nits, so you can do everything from taking meeting notes and making digital sketches to streaming and web surfing with better visibility. Weighing just 320 grams, the Tab One is light and compact enough to travel with you on your commute to work ...
